2.2 Training course materials and curricula review

 

The curricula and course materials should be reviewed against the requirements of the IALA model courses and any requirements of the Competent Authority. The reviewer should identify any areas where the curricula and course materials have not adequately addressed requirements of the model course and Competent Authority requirements.

 

2.3 Review of instructor and examiner qualifications

 

Evidence of instructor and examiner qualifications should be reviewed to ensure their qualifications are suitable for the functions they perform. In the event that the Phase 1 assessment is performed at a location other than the Training Institute, copies of instructor and examiner qualifications may be utilised.

 

2.4 Review of internal audit program

 

The Training Institute's internal audit program schedule should be examined to ensure that a complete audit of the management system and training activities will be completed prior to initiation of the Phase 2 assessment.

 

2.5 Reporting

 

The results of Phase 1 assessment activities should be documented in a report. The report should identify the names of the documents reviewed, and summarise the results of the phase 1 assessment.

 

The reviewer should identify any deficiencies in the TMS documentation, course curricula or course materials. The Training Institute should be responsible for correcting the deficiencies and reporting the proposed corrective actions to the reviewer for acceptance prior to the phase 2 assessment. If the proposed corrective actions are acceptable, the reviewer should, by documented correspondence with Training Institute, indicate acceptance of the proposed corrective actions and closure of the documentation review.

 

3 Phase 2

 

Phase 2 consists of an assessment of:

・Audit planning and scheduling;

・Audit of the effective implementation of the documented training management system;

・Reporting.

 

3.1 Audit planning and scheduling

 

The Phase 2 audit should be conducted in accordance with an audit plan. The audit plan should be developed in co-ordination with the training institute, and utilising knowledge gained during Phase 1.

 

Where Phase 1 activities are conducted on site, the audit plan may be developed with the direct participation of the Training Institute at the close of the Phase 1 activities. Where Phase I activities are not conducted on site, the audit plan should be developed in liaison with the Training Institute.

 

The audit plan used for the assessment prior to the issue of an Accreditation certificate should be reviewed and up-dated as necessary for periodic audits.
